How they compare
South Korea currently reports 0.3433 current US$ per US$ of GDP against 0.181 current US$ per US$ of GDP in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D), a difference of 0.1623 current US$ per US$ of GDP.
That makes South Korea's figure about 1.9 times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D)'s.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) ahead.
South Korea ranks 28th and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) ranks 31st of 187 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, South Korea averaged higher in 5 and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| South Korea |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 0.0897 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.1419 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.0523 current US$ per US$ of GDP |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) |
| 1970s | 0.2282 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.2827 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.0546 current US$ per US$ of GDP |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) |
| 1980s | 0.3353 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.1978 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.1375 current US$ per US$ of GDP | South Korea |
| 1990s | 0.3799 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.2269 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.1531 current US$ per US$ of GDP | South Korea |
| 2000s | 0.3396 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.313 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.0267 current US$ per US$ of GDP | South Korea |
| 2010s | 0.3497 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.2495 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.1002 current US$ per US$ of GDP | South Korea |
| 2020s | 0.3417 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.226 current US$ per US$ of GDP | 0.1158 current US$ per US$ of GDP | South Korea |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Gross domestic savings (current US$) div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
